Easier = noob
ZBrush has reversible poly mesh subdivision, as well as every painting option you can think of. It's just superior. And why I say you should be using ZBrush with your model is this; Create a VERY basic model in 3ds max, I'll boot up my 3ds max and give example pics in a bit, then move the obj file over to Zbrush (mudbox if you really want to) then sculpt out the larger dragon-like details from there, then subdivide, go into more detail, subdivide, more detail, sub etc. Wings would be something you would model separately then attach later on. First off I box modeled the dragon, starting with one box, 2 width segments.
Then convert it to an editable poly. and start extruding the sides. (switched to 3ds max 10, just cause I like the modeling controls better) Save the model as .obj wherever (export) OPENZBRUSHBITCHES and then import your model Then just subdivide it (ctrl D) and get to work! This part kinda depends on your own artistic level, but after you're satisfied with the details you have, subdivide again, and add more, and so on.
